Antimicrobial Silver Wound Dressing in Canada Trends and Forecast
The future of the ant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ada looks promising with opportunities in the hospital & clinic and home care markets. The global antimicrobial silver wound dressing market is expected to grow with a CAGR of 3.5% from 2025 to 2031. The ant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ada is also forecasted to witness strong growth over the forecast period. The major drivers for this market are the increasing cases of chronic wound infections, the rising demand for advanced wound care, and the growing geriatric patient population globally.
• Lucintel forecasts that, within the type category, silver foam dressing is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period.
• Within the application category, home care is expected to witness the highest growth.

Antimicrobial Silver Wound Dressing Market in Canada Driver and Challenges
The ant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ada is influenced by a variety of technological, economic, and regulatory factors. Advances in medical technology and increasing healthcare awareness drive demand for innovative wound care solutions. Economic factors such as healthcare funding and patient affordability impact market growth, while regulatory standards ensure safety and efficacy. Additionally, demographic shifts, including an aging population, contribute to the rising need for effective wound management products. These drivers, combined with challenges like regulatory hurdles, high product costs, and competition, shape the overall landscape of the market, influencing its growth trajectory and innovation potential.
The factors responsible for driving the ant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ada include:-
• Technological Innovation: The development of advanced silver-based dressings with improved antimicrobial properties and biocompatibility is a key driver. Innovations such as nanotechnology-enhanced dressings offer better infection control and faster healing, attracting healthcare providers and patients. Continuous R&D investments foster product differentiation and market expansion, making these dressings more effective and versatile for various wound types.
• Rising Incidence of Chronic Wounds: An aging population and increasing prevalence of diabetes and vascular diseases contribute to a higher incidence of chronic wounds like diabetic foot ulcers and pressure sores. These wounds require effective management to prevent infections, which boosts demand for antimicrobial dressings. The growing burden on healthcare systems further accelerates the adoption of advanced wound care products.
• Healthcare Infrastructure Development: Canada’s expanding healthcare infrastructure, including specialized wound care centers and hospitals, supports the adoption of innovative dressings. Investments in healthcare facilities and training ensure proper utilization of advanced antimicrobial products, fostering market growth. Enhanced healthcare access and awareness also promote the use of these dressings in both hospital and home-care settings.
• Regulatory Approvals and Standards: Stringent regulatory frameworks in Canada ensure the safety and efficacy of wound dressings. Approval processes by agencies like Health Canada influence product development and market entry strategies. Companies investing in compliance and quality assurance can gain competitive advantages, although regulatory hurdles may delay product launches and increase costs.
• Increasing Healthcare Expenditure: Rising healthcare spending in Canada, driven by government initiatives and private sector investments, supports the adoption of advanced wound care solutions. Higher budgets enable hospitals and clinics to procure innovative antimicrobial dressings, improving patient outcomes. This economic support encourages manufacturers to expand their product portfolios and distribution channels.
The challenges in the ant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ada are:-
• Regulatory Hurdles: Navigating complex approval processes in Canada can be time-consuming and costly. Stringent safety and efficacy requirements demand extensive clinical data, delaying product launches and increasing R&D expenses. Smaller companies may struggle to meet these standards, limiting market entry and innovation.
• High Product Costs: Advanced silver-based dressings often involve expensive raw materials and manufacturing processes, resulting in higher prices. This can limit accessibility for patients and healthcare providers, especially in cost-sensitive settings. Reimbursement issues and budget constraints further hinder widespread adoption, impacting market growth.
• Intense Market Competition: The presence of numerous local and international players creates a highly competitive environment. Companies must differentiate their products through innovation, quality, and pricing strategies. Competitive pressures can lead to price wars and reduced profit margins, challenging new entrants and existing manufacturers to sustain growth.
In summary, the antimicrobial silver wound dressing market in Canada is shaped by technological advancements, demographic trends, and healthcare infrastructure development, which drive growth. However, regulatory complexities, high costs, and intense competition pose significant challenges. Overall, these factors collectively influence market dynamics, requiring stakeholders to innovate and adapt to sustain growth and improve patient outcomes in wound care management.
